Importantly, these receptors were observed to have been activated by a wide range of endogenous opioids in a focus just like that noticed for activation and signaling of classical opiate receptors. Consequently, these receptors have been located to own scavenging action, binding to and decreasing endogenous amounts of opiates obtainable for binding to opiate receptors (fifty nine). This scavenging activity was discovered to provide guarantee being a adverse regulator of opiate operate and as an alternative fashion of Regulate on the classical opiate signaling pathway.

Szpakowska et al. also examined conolidone and its action over the ACKR3 receptor, which will help to elucidate its Formerly not known mechanism of action in both acute and Continual pain control (58). It had been found that receptor levels of ACKR3 ended up as higher or maybe higher as People of your endogenous opiate program and had been correlated to similar areas of the CNS. This receptor was also not modulated by basic opiate agonists, including morphine, fentanyl, buprenorphine, or antagonists like naloxone. Within a rat design, it had been observed that a competitor molecule binding to ACKR3 resulted in inhibition of ACKR3’s inhibitory exercise, producing an overall increase in opiate receptor exercise.
